2C5H11OH+O2 to give CO2 +H2O. How many moles of O2 are needed for combustion of 1 mole of alkanol

The equation for the reaction is;

"2C_5H_{11}OH+15O_2\\to 10CO_2+12H_2O"

Mole ratio of Pentanol to Oxygen "=2:15"

Moles of Oxygen"=15\\times1mole\\over2" "=7.5 moles O_2"
